RECYLCING ITEMS *ACCEPTED* – Recycling placed in plastic bags will not be picked up

  • Aluminum and Glass – Beverage and Food Cans/Jars/ Bottles – Rinsed Clean
  • Plastic Beverage/Food Bottles – Plastic #1 and #2 only – Rinsed Clean
  • Newspaper, Magazine, Junk Mail, & Office Paper – no shredded paper allowed
  • Cardboard – flatten and remove all Styrofoam, which is not recyclable. Separate cardboard from commingled

ITEMS *NOT ACCEPTED* FOR RECYCLING

  • Styrofoam – Bubble Wrap – Packing Peanuts – Shredded Paper – Paper Towels/Dishes – Food – Animal Waste
  • Appliances – Electronics – Wires – Light Bulbs – Batteries – Ceramics – Dishes – Pyrex – Mirrors – Window Glass
  • Hazardous Material Containers – Needles – Syringes – Metal
  • Plastics #3 #4 #5 #6 #7
  • Pizza Boxes – due to grease and residue. Cardboard must be clean to be recyclable.
  • Plastic Bags – recycle at local grocery store

YARD WASTE (Thursdays – April 13, 2023, through November 30, 2023 – no exceptions)

  • Place grass clippings and shrubbery in open containers weighing no more than thirty pounds – do not put in bags
  • Tree branches, limbs, trimmings; not to exceed 3’ length or 1.5” diameter – tie and bundle or will not be picked up

YARD WASTE ITEMS NOT ACCEPTED

  • No full trees accepted
  • No yard waste from landscaping companies

LEAVES (Thursdays – October 26, 2023, until December 14, 2023 (no collection Thursday, November 23, 2023)

  • Place leaves on tree lawn, sidewalks, or grass. Do not block sewer drains in street.

OTHER RECYCLABLE ITEMS AND WHERE TO RECYCLE

  • Antifreeze, Lead-Acid Batteries, Oil           Kost Tire, 1801 Wyoming Ave, 570-693-4442
  • Auto Tires, $3 fee per tire                            Kost Tire, 1801 Wyoming Ave, 570-693-4442
  • Gasoline, Mercury Light Bulbs (tubes)       Lowe’s or Home Depot, please call first to verify
  • Small Electronics (no TVs)                            Best Buy, check their website for what they accept in our area
  • Tube/Flat Screen TVs                                    Salvation Army on Sans Souci Parkway – bring to truck in parking lot
